M2Team / NanaZip

The 7-Zip derivative intended for the modern Windows experience
https://sourceforge.net/projects/nanazip/
Other
8.75k stars 222 forks source link

Nanazip only shows in context menu for folders #51

Closed bwat47 closed 1 year ago

bwat47 commented 2 years ago

After installing nanazip on windows 10 (from windows store), I see that nanazip does show in the context menu (as expected) when right clicking on a folder:

image

However, it does NOT show in the context menu when right clicking on a file:

image

NOTE: This is the case even after restarting explorer.exe and even after rebooting the machine

MouriNaruto commented 2 years ago

image

I can't reproduce your issue in my Windows 10 environment.

Kenji Mouri

bwat47 commented 2 years ago

Not sure what the environmental difference could be,

I'm running 21H2 build 19044.1348

I tried creating a brand new local windows user profile but I still see the same behavior with the new windows user

MouriNaruto commented 2 years ago

@bwat47

I'm running 21H2 build 19044.1348

My Windows 10 environment is the same build.

Kenji Mouri

komawoyo commented 2 years ago

Nanazip in context menu is working for both old and new context menu in Windows 11. @bwat47 you might have additional tweaks that might be interfering with NanaZip. You can make sure its really a bug if you run and test on a virtual machine. Clean install. .

bwat47 commented 2 years ago

weird... no idea what could be interfering. any other software I install (e.g. 7-zip, winrar, etc...) shows in the context menu for files without issue

PicoPlanetDev commented 2 years ago

image

This actually happened to me before I rebooted my computer after installing NanaZip. After I rebooted, it worked just fine as shown above.

Heart1010 commented 2 years ago

I have exactly the same problem than @bwat47 - on folder the context menu is there but not on files (win10).

restarted file explorer process and also did a full pc reboot - no change.

MouriNaruto commented 2 years ago

@Heart1010

https://github.com/M2Team/NanaZip/issues/2#issuecomment-927323040

Kenji Mouri

bwat47 commented 2 years ago

I have several other machines that I tried nanazip on:

one running windows 10, and two running windows 11, and it works fine on those machines... no idea what could be preventing it from working on this one windows 10 machine (rebooting doesn't help).

NOTE: On the problem machine, I tried the UWP files app mentioned above, and nanazip doesn't show at all in that app (doesn't matter if I right click a file or folder)... however, 7-zip does show

bwat47 commented 2 years ago

I updated the machine in question to windows 11, and I no longer see the issue there

nanazip shows in the context menu for both files and folders, in both the new & old context menu

SakuraNeko commented 2 years ago

@bwat47 :

This is indeed puzzling. Do these problematic devices have similar characteristics? For example, their OS versions.

We will continue to follow up on this issue and if we find anything we will let you know here immediately.

Sakura Neko

Heart1010 commented 2 years ago

I can only confirm @bwat47 - as said exactly same behaviour. I also tried to installed mentioned Files app above - here I also have only the NanaZip context menu when right click a folder but not when right click a file.

I had the normal 7zip version installed before trying NanaZip and uninstalled that 7zip version (7zip had the correct context menus) - eventually these old registry values from 7ip are a problem? Don't know...

Edition Windows 10 Pro Version 21H2 Installiert am ‎21.‎10.‎2020 Betriebssystembuild 19044.1348 Leistung Windows Feature Experience Pack 120.2212.3920.0

bwat47 commented 2 years ago

The one device of mine that had the problem was running windows 10 21h2

The devices that had no problems were: 2 Windows 11 devices 1 Windows 10 device (but running a build older than 21h2) - EDIT: This device has been updated to 21h2 and still has no issues

The only other difference I can think of on the working devices vs the device that had the issue was that I'm fairly certain the other devices never had 7-zip installed.

That said, on the problem device, I had tried uninstalling 7-zip, using ccleaner to clean the leftover 7-zip registry entries, and rebooting and still saw the same behavior

FadeMind commented 2 years ago

I confirm issue. For folders menu NanaZip show up. For files nope.

Windows 10 21H2 19044.1387

Even external app cannot see registry entries for menu handlers.

AdrianDeWinter commented 2 years ago

Me too. I have had a look at my registry permissions since i did change some of those to add options to folder context menus, but nothing is jumping out at me. Also, since the only things i changed were permissions on those keys regarding folder context menus, and those are the only ones where NanaZip does show up, i don't think that is the cause.

I can provide screenshots of those permissions if you require them.

Also:

Edition Windows 10 Pro Version 21H2 Installed on ‎25/‎08/‎2020 OS build 19044.1466 Experience Windows Feature Experience Pack 120.2212.3920.0

FadeMind commented 2 years ago

NanaZip Preview show up context menu entries after reboot in WIndows 11. In Windows 10 entries was visible only for directories, not files. In Windows 11 all is fine.

AndromedaMelody commented 1 year ago

Thanks for your support.